Geocache Description:

Caches 13-34 are the first extension to the Alconbury Amble.

This section still starts you off near the Recreation Field (which has a car park) and will take you on a leisurely stroll around the countryside north-west of the village before returning you to the vicinity of the Recreation Field.

This route is not particularly wheelchair friendly but that is mostly due to a couple of kissing gates rather than terrain.

Container is small plastic box with room for smallish swaps etc. About the same size as poshrules A1 clip lock boxes.
